pow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/ Получить результат работы функции SQL
11 сообщений из 11, страница 1 из 1
Получить результат работы функции SQL
    #36339765
Лампочка
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всем привет! есть функция на скл-е, возвращает 0 или 1, сама получает параметр integer. Нужно считать это значение в 9 билдере.
делаю в билдере ls_select = "select my_function(1);"
потом с помощью курсора делаю fetch - не работает (всегда дает ноль).
а то же самое в скл-е работает..что делать?
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36339780
Фотография Филипп
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Почитать хелп топик Declaring DBMS stored procedures as remote procedure calls
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36339792
Dmitry..
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ls_select = "select my_function(1)"
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36339842
Лампочка
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Филипп, спасибо! проверю только завтра, но, по-моему, у нас такое уже пользуется.
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340400
VanoR
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Код: plaintext
1.
int li_li
select my_function( 1 ) into :li_li from ( select  1  ) t(a);
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340571
Лампочка
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А что такое t(a)?

Всем ответившим спасибо, но не работает ни один вариант. Не кушает билдер функции.
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340604
VanoR
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
что значит не кушает? sqlerrtext что выдает?
у меня работают именно так

( select 1 ) t(a) - это тоже самое что Dual в оракле
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340622
Лампочка
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
начнем с того, что у меня в самом скл-е не запускается :
select ir_ExsConditionsLoanTypes(1) from ( select 1 ) t(a)

как же она тогда из билдера должна сработать?
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340648
Лампочка
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ура! VanoR,спасибо!!! работает!! там надо было просто приставку dbo добавить.
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340662
VanoR
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Лампочканачнем с того, что у меня в самом скл-е не запускается :
select ir_ExsConditionsLoanTypes(1) from ( select 1 ) t(a)
в самом скл-е и не должно так запускаться
там просто select ir_ExsConditionsLoanTypes(1)
а ( select 1 ) t(a) - это чтоб чтото было во FROM... ведь без FROM билдер не понимает
...
Рейтинг: 0 / 0
Получить результат работы функции SQL
    #36340756
Лампочка
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Еще раз спасибо, все получилось!
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/ PowerBuilder [игнор отключен] [закрыт для гостей] / Получить результат работы функции SQL
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]